What we need to focus on is that now that the GTR has been bought by customers and tested, the performance numbers aren't matching the hype of the 'prototypes' tested in all the rags...
Near as I can tell, The U.S. spec, U.S. delivered GT-R seems to be about as quick as the early tests made it seem.

The worst-case example is the sick one that Car & Driver tested (plus one with the sniffles, apparently), but follow-ups have led to a couple of articles about production U.S. spec GT-Rs being underrated, horsepower-wise.

The norm seems to be quarter miles in the 11.6 - 11.8 area, with trap speeds near or at 120 mph.
